What the Appraisers Are In Fact Looking For



Many individuals presume appraisers merely consider a product and estimate a number. The procedure is far more nuanced than that. Auction house appraisers trained in fine art, furniture, fashion jewelry, and collectibles evaluate problem, provenance, comparable recent sales, and present market demand. They take a look at the rear of paints, the bottoms of ceramics, the joints of furnishings, and hallmarks marked right into metalwork. Bringing documents, initial packaging, or any kind of invoices you have can reinforce their assessment significantly.



If you have documents pertaining to an acquisition, an old insurance policy that recommendations the item, or perhaps household photos showing the item in its initial context, bring all of it. Those information assist evaluators develop a much more accurate and defensible valuation, which matters whether you are considering marketing or simply want the information for insurance policy objectives.

Preparing Your Items Before You Show up



Withstand need to tidy or bring back anything prior to an appraiser sees it. Well-meaning sprucing up of silver, refinishing of furnishings, or cleansing of coins can substantially decrease worth by getting rid of the initial aging or surface that collection agencies and buyers prize. Bring products as you located them, and allow the specialists make that phone call.



It also assists to photo your items before leaving home, both for your own documents and because high-resolution photos can assist the appraiser in referencing comparable examples. If an item is also large or breakable to deliver securely, clear photos from several angles, consisting of any type of marks, trademarks, or damages, offer Bay Area Auctioneers and expert appraisers enough to provide a sensible preliminary quote right away.



Exactly How Cost-free Appraisal Events Work in Method



The style at most complimentary area appraisal days is straightforward. You arrive with your items, join a queue, and spend a few minutes with a professional who reviews what you have actually brought. The conversation usually covers recognition, age, problem, and an approximated market value variety. Some events provide composed estimates while others keep the exchange spoken, so it deserves asking in advance what style to expect.



These events are deliberately obtainable. You do not require to be a skilled collection agency or have a high-value piece to get involved. The objective is to provide community participants sincere, skilled insight right into what they have. Auction appraisals conducted in this layout are specifically beneficial since the professionals included are proactively engaged with the existing resale market, indicating their appraisals mirror genuine purchaser demand, not outdated price overviews.
